On 15-10-15 10:44, Daniel P. Berrange wrote:
> On Thu, Oct 15, 2015 at 10:28:39AM +0200, Wido den Hollander wrote:
>> When a RBD volume has snapshots it can not be removed.
>>
>> This patch introduces a new flag to force volume removal,
>> VIR_STORAGE_VOL_DELETE_FORCED.
>>
>> With this flag any existing snapshots will be removed prior
>> to removing the volume.
>>
>> No existing mechanism in libvirt allowed us to pass such information,
>> so that's why a new flag was introduced.
>>

> 
> Long term I could imagine there will be a number of reasons why
> it might be forbidden to delete a volume by default. It would be
> nice to selectively override these reasons. FORCED is quite a
> generic name for a specific action. So how about naming it
> VOL_DELETE_WITH_SNAPSHOTS
> 

Seems like a good thing to me. Want me to submit a new patch?

Before I do so, any code-wide objections?
